| /* Though test_pkt_access_subprog2() is defined in C as: |
| * static __attribute__ ((noinline)) |
| * int test_pkt_access_subprog2(int val, volatile struct __sk_buff *skb) |
| * { |
| * return skb->len * val; |
| * } |
| * llvm optimizations remove 'int val' argument and generate BPF assembly: |
| * r0 = *(u32 *)(r1 + 0) |
| * w0 <<= 1 |
| * exit |
| * In such case the verifier falls back to conservative and |
| * tracing program can access arguments and return value as u64 |
| * instead of accurate types. |
| */ |
